DESCRIPTION (Adapted from applicant's abstract): This is a proposal to
continue studies on signaling via histamine H2 receptors in gastric parietal
cells. The Principal Investigator (PI) and his colleagues have
characterized the molecular structure and function of the cloned H2 receptor
and determined that it activates adenylate cyclase and phospholipase C (PLC)
in a GTP-dependent, cholera toxin-sensitive manner. The mechanisms whereby
the receptor couples to two effector systems remain to be determined.
Furthermore, the PI has recently found that the receptor mediates cell
proliferation and transcriptional activation of the early response gene,
c-fos. In the current proposal the following will be examined. (1)
Chimeric receptor constructs and site directed mutagenesis will be used to
elucidate the structural components of the receptor linked to activation of
adenylate cyclase and phospholipase C; (2) the G proteins involved in H2
receptor signaling in primary and transformed cells will be characterized
using selective antibodies, immunoblotting, GTP-labeling and molecular
techniques; and (3) the biological significance of dual signaling will be
explored. H2 receptor/G protein targeted oligopeptides, antisera and
antisense probes will be used to determine the relative importance of the
two signaling pathways in cell proliferation and parietal cell secretory
activity.
